Transaction 70dbb6800f614385f1f3637539c465bee86d051f88a12e7107bd23c938d0d33f

78 Input
2 Outputs
  • 70dbb6800f614385f1f3637539c465bee86d051f88a12e7107bd23c938d0d33f:0
  • value  245398
    address  bc1q7f5d096c6ngg6hk2kuhntxsyszjjyjdyzqhsfg
  • 70dbb6800f614385f1f3637539c465bee86d051f88a12e7107bd23c938d0d33f:1
  • value  70000000
    address  1KXPS2m9pmPqcu6mk2GnxWC854jACrMjZ7